Abstract
In order to attain the maximum permissible speed of a stepping motor and to achieve a substantial reduction in the time required to perform a predetermined number of steps, acceleration between the starting speed V.sub.o and the maximum speed V.sub.m takes place in the form of incremental increases .DELTA.V.sub.n in the frequency of the signal for controlling the speed of the motor at time intervals .DELTA.t which are all equal. All the speeds V.sub.n-1 +.DELTA.V.sub.n are precomputed by a microprocessor and the precomputed values are stored in memory. These values are read at each instant t+.DELTA.t during the acceleration period and in the reverse order with respect to the deceleration period. The curve velocity V is a function of time t is of exponential form with a negative exponent.
